Spring Repair
Torsion springs carry your door’s entire weight. In Leicester’s position in the Worcester Hills snow belt, where annual snowfall routinely exceeds 60 inches and temperatures drop below zero during nor’easters, those springs become brittle and snap without warning. We see it every winter. We serviced a 1960s ranch on Paxton Street last January where a snapped torsion spring left the door stuck halfway at 0°F. The homeowner had ignored the brittle-spring signs from prior winters. We replaced the springs with cold-rated units, realigned the frost-heaved track, and advised on a full retrofit since the original wood framing couldn’t support a modern insulated door. Spring repair in Leicester runs $180-$340, and we always recommend cold-rated replacement springs for this climate.

Track Realignment
Along Leicester’s older rural roads, detached garages commonly sit on shallow fieldstone or poured-concrete perimeter foundations that heave noticeably each winter. By spring, door tracks are pulled out of plumb. This isn’t a correctable one-time fix. It’s a seasonal pattern experienced local techs recognize immediately and plan for as an annual adjustment call. We realign tracks, check header bowing from ice load, and assess whether the foundation shift has progressed to where a retrofit makes more sense than continued repairs. Track realignment in Leicester costs $120-$240.

Cable Repair
Cables work with springs to lift and lower the door safely. When springs snap or tracks misalign, cables fray, unspool, or snap under uneven load. Leicester’s freeze-thaw cycling accelerates corrosion on older galvanized cables, especially in detached garages with poor sealing. We replace cables with aircraft-grade galvanized or stainless steel depending on your door’s age and exposure. Cable repair in Leicester runs $130-$250. We never recommend operating a door with a damaged cable; the spring tension is genuinely dangerous and requires proper tools and training to release safely.

Panel Replacement
Many Leicester garages still have original wood or early steel panels from the 1950s-70s. Single-panel replacement is sometimes possible if the manufacturer still exists and the panel style wasn’t discontinued. More often, we find that rust, rot, or impact damage on one panel signals broader deterioration, and the hardware mounting points no longer align with modern replacement panels. We’ll give you an honest assessment: repairable panel replacement in Leicester runs $295-$590, but if your track hardware, spring system, and opener are all original, a full door retrofit may be the square deal over repeated piecemeal repairs.

Common Garage Door Repair Problems We See in Leicester Homes
- Torsion spring failure during nor’easters. Sub-zero snaps are common in Leicester’s amplified snow track. The sound is loud, the door is dead-weight, and it’s always during the worst weather. We carry cold-rated replacement springs rated for Worcester County’s temperature swings.
- Bottom seals frozen to concrete sills. Leicester’s November-through-March freeze-thaw cycling causes rubber seals to bond with frost-heaved concrete. Forcing the door tears the seal and damages the retainer. We replace seals with wider-profile vinyl or add sill heating where appropriate.
- Annual track misalignment from frost heave. Fieldstone and shallow concrete foundations shift every winter along rural Leicester roads. By April, doors bind and openers strain. We realign, but we also tell you honestly if the foundation movement has reached the point where annual adjustment is your ongoing reality.
- Ice damming bowing garage headers. Low-slope garage roofs common on Leicester’s older detached structures collect snow load that bows headers and racks door frames. We assess structural integrity before recommending hardware fixes that won’t hold.

No, it’s not normal, but it’s common in Leicester’s unheated detached garages. The issue is usually hardened grease in the opener rail, contracted drive components, or a safety sensor knocked out of alignment by frost-heaved framing. Sometimes the opener is simply undersized for a door that’s become heavier as seals ice up. We diagnose the root cause rather than replacing parts blindly. Opener repair runs $140-$380. Apply silicone spray to the seal and sill before the first hard freeze, keep the apron clear of snow and ice buildup, and ensure your garage drains away from the door. If your Leicester garage has a low spot where meltwater pools, that water refreezes nightly and bonds the seal. We can install a wider-profile vinyl seal with better release characteristics or modify the sill slope.
